- Airship_Development_AD1 comment "The Airship Development AD1 was a British non-rigid gas-filled advertising airship. The airship had a 60,000 cubic feet envelope made by the Reginald Foster Dagnall Company of Guildford. The airship, registered G-FAAX, was erected at Cramlington airfield near Newcastle where it was test flown on 6 November 1929.".
